A 7.0 ?, a 15 ? and a 19.0 ? resistor are connected in series with a 24.0 V battery.
a). Calculate the equivalent resistance. Answer in units of ?
b). What is the current in the circuit? Answer in units of A
c). What is the current in each resistor? Answer in units of A
